WebbIndian philosophy, the systems of thought and reflection that were developed by the civilizations of the Indian subcontinent. They include both orthodox systems, namely, the Nyaya, Vaisheshika, Samkhya, Yoga, Purva-Mimamsa (or Mimamsa), and Vedanta (Advaita, Dwaita, Bhedbheda, Vishistadvaita), and unorthodox (nastika) systems, such as … WebbCONSTITUTIONAL PROVISIONS 3. The Constitution of India is considered as a distinctive constitution around the globe. black and decker all in one proWebb21 juni 2024 · The Indian constitution does not refer to the country as a federation. Article 1 of the Indian constitution, on the other hand, refers to India as a “Union of States.”. This signifies that India is a union made up of many states that are all intertwined. The states are unable to secede from the union in this situation. black and decker authorized dealer
